How do you become a business development specialist in Michigan?

Most Michigan employers require a bachelor's degree in business administration, marketing, or a related discipline as the baseline qualification. Business development specialists in Michigan are not subject to a state-issued license or mandatory certification, so entry depends on education combined with demonstrated sales or client development experience. Earning a Certified Business Development Professional credential or a Michigan-recognized project management certification can strengthen a candidacy, particularly for roles in regulated industries like healthcare or financial services.

How much do business development specialists make in Michigan?

Business development specialists in Michigan earn a median of about $66,780 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$40,930 for the lowest 10% to over $127,190 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

How can I get hired as a business development specialist in Michigan with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is a sales development representative or inside sales associate role, which large Michigan employers across automotive technology, staffing, and healthcare routinely use as a feeder into business development positions. Companies like Stefanini, Beaumont Health, and regional Tier 1 auto suppliers hire graduates directly into associate BD or account coordinator programs. Building a portfolio of prospecting work, completing a HubSpot or Salesforce certification, and targeting Michigan's professional staffing agencies for contract-to-hire opportunities all strengthen a candidate without prior formal experience.
